Throughout pregnancy, generalised stress and anxiety problem has an occurrence of as much as 10.5% and in the postpartum duration, it depends on 10.8%. And while anxiousness disorders generally start in childhood and early the adult years, symptoms show up to decline with age. Keeping that, the United State Preventive Providers Task Pressure (USPSTF) advises that medical professionals display for anxiousness conditions in all grownups up to 65, consisting of people who are expectant have just provided birth, according to the job pressure's declaration published in JAMA.
